الملخص EN

Background.

Quercus infectoria (QI) is a plant used in traditional medicines in Asia.

The plant was reported to contain various active phytochemical compounds that have potential to stimulate bone formation.

However, the precise mechanism of the stimulation effect of QI on osteoblast has not been elucidated.

The present study was carried out to isolate QI semipurified fractions from aqueous QI extract and to delineate the molecular mechanism of QI semipurified fraction that enhanced bone formation by using hFOB1.19 human fetal osteoblast cell model.

Methods.

Isolation of QI semipurified fractions was established by means of column chromatography and thin layer chromatography.

Established QI semipurified fractions were identified using Liquid Chromatography-Mass Spectrometry (LC-MS).

Cells were treated with derived QI semipurified fractions and investigated for mineralization deposition and protein expression level of BMP-2, Runx2, and OPN by ELISA followed gene expression analysis of BMP-2 and Runx2 by RT-PCR.

Results.

Column chromatography isolation and purification yield Fractions A, B, and C.

LC-MS analysis reveals the presence of polyphenols in each fraction.

Results show that QI semipurified fractions increased the activity and upregulated the gene expression of BMP-2 and Runx2 at day 1, day 3, and day 7.

OPN activity increased in cells treated with QI semipurified fractions at day 1 and day 3.

Meanwhile, at day 7, expression of OPN decreased in activity.

Furthermore, the study showed that combination of Fractions A, B, and C with osteoporotic drug (pamidronate) further increased the activity and upregulated the gene expression of BMP-2 and Runx2.

Conclusions.

These findings demonstrated that polyphenols from semipurified fractions of QI enhanced bone formation through expression of the investigated bone-related marker that is its potential role when combined with readily available osteoporotic drug.
